The Scientific Basis for Massage Therapy Benefits
What contributes to massage therapy being so effective in bolstering well-being? The research supporting this method rests on its ability to regulate the body's physical and mental conditions. Therapeutic massage increases circulatory flow, strengthening the movement of nutrients and oxygen to tissues while supporting the removal of waste products. This improved blood flow can facilitate speedier recuperation from physical damage and lessened muscular tension. Moreover, the manual contact involved in therapeutic work promotes the release of endorphins, the body's pain-relieving substances, cultivating a feeling of serenity and relaxation.
Moreover, evidence indicates that massage therapy can affect the autonomic nervous system, transitioning it from a state of stress to one of peace. This stability helps sustain heart rate and blood pressure, boosting overall health. By tackling both physical and emotional aspects, massage therapy represents a integrated method to improving wellness, making it a essential component in health management.
Why Therapeutic Massage Relieves Stress and Anxiety
Massage therapy promotes an heightened state of relaxation, which can significantly reduce stress and anxiety. Evidence indicates that it successfully lowers cortisol levels, contributing to a more peaceful mental state. Additionally, the practice encourages better emotional control, promoting emotional well-being.
Improved Calming State
The gentle contact of skilled hands can induce a deep relaxation response, effectively diminishing anxiety and tension. Massage treatment helps in releasing tension from the muscles, supporting an overall feeling of calm. This physical release helps individuals to feel more grounded, enabling their minds to enter a calm state. Clients commonly share experiencing a significant reduction in fast thoughts and mental clutter both during and after a session. Furthermore, the rhythmic rhythm of massage can trigger a meditative state, enhancing emotional well-being. As the body relaxes, the heart rate typically slows, and breathing becomes deeper and more even. This complete relaxation response fosters immediate relief and supports long-term improvements in managing stress and overall mental health.
Decreased Cortisol Levels
While many seek relaxation through various methods, studies shows that therapeutic massage effectively lowers cortisol levels, a primary stress hormone. High cortisol is often linked to chronic stress, which can result in multiple health problems, including anxiety and depression. Studies show that consistent therapeutic massage can substantially reduce these cortisol levels, promoting a state of calm and well-being. This reduction not only eases immediate stress responses but also adds to long-term health benefits. By lowering cortisol, therapeutic massage can help people handle their stress more effectively, enhancing their overall quality of life. In addition, lower cortisol levels may enhance sleep and boost immune function, establishing a holistic approach to wellness and relaxation.
Better Emotional Control
Although many elements influence emotional well-being, research indicates that massage therapy is vital for improving emotional stability by reducing stress and anxiety. The physiological effects of massage, such as enhanced circulation and muscle relaxation, help creating a sense of calm. Studies have shown that regular sessions produce lower levels of cortisol, the stress hormone, while elevating serotonin and dopamine, neurotransmitters responsible for happiness and relaxation. Clients often report fewer symptoms of anxiety and depression after treatment, which strengthens overall emotional resilience. By addressing both physical and emotional tension, massage therapy provides a valuable tool for individuals aiming to improve their mental health and achieve a balanced mood.

Types Of Massage Techniques
The broad world of therapeutic massage encompasses a variety of techniques, each tailored to address unique needs and preferences. Swedish massage stands as one of the most favored methods, focusing on smooth, extended strokes to support relaxation. Deep tissue massage ventures deeper into muscular tissue to alleviate stubborn tension. Sports massage targets athletes, strengthening athletic capacity and aiding recovery through focused methods. Shiatsu, a Japanese method, uses finger pressure on specific areas to restore energy flow. Meanwhile, aromatherapy massage unites essential oils with gentle methods to enhance relaxation and emotional well-being. Finally, prenatal massage is designed for expectant mothers, providing comfort and relief from pregnancy-related discomfort. Each method offers distinctive experiences and can fulfill to individual wellness goals.

Tips for Selecting the Ideal Massage for Your Objectives
In what way can one determine the most ideal massage type to match personal wellness goals? First, it is necessary to recognize specific needs, such as relaxation, pain relief, or improved mobility. For stress reduction, Swedish massage may be ideal, underlining gentle techniques that promote relaxation. Conversely, for muscle tension or chronic pain, deep tissue massage targets deeper layers of muscle and connective tissue.
Individuals pursuing enhanced athletic performance could benefit from sports massage, which focuses on improving flexibility and reducing the risk of injury. Additionally, those curious about holistic approaches might explore aromatherapy massages, adding essential oils for enhanced relaxation and mood improvement.
Talking to a accredited massage expert can furnish valuable insights into which techniques suit best for personal aims. By getting to know the multiple varieties of therapeutic treatment and their rewards, individuals can make informed choices that truly correspond with their wellness goals.

What to Prepare For During Your Introductory Massage Experience
After acknowledging massage therapy as an essential element of a well-being routine, individuals might wonder what their first session will involve. Usually, the experience starts with a short consultation during which the therapist checks the client's medical history, preferences, and particular areas of concern. This conversation provides a personalized approach designed for individual needs.
Once settled, patients are led to a private room and told to change to their level of comfort, often under a towel or sheet for privacy. The therapist will present methods, outlining the procedure and addressing any concerns. Opening touches may seem unfamiliar, but the therapist will fine-tune force according to responses.
Throughout the appointment, relaxation is the focus, and clients are asked to report any discomfort. Post-massage, clients typically get aftercare guidance, including fluid consumption tips and optional stretches. Altogether, the first session provides the basis for a therapeutic relationship aimed at wellness.

What Ought I Wear Throughout a Massage Session?
During a massage treatment, people generally wear loose, comfortable clothing or may opt to undress to their level of comfort. Massage therapists offer draping for privacy, maintaining comfort while preserving professionalism throughout the visit.
Are There Any Side Effects of Massage Therapy?
Massage therapy can cause mild side effects, encompassing temporary soreness, bruising, or fatigue. Individuals suffering from certain medical conditions may experience more significant reactions, making consulting a healthcare professional earlier advisable for personalized guidance.
